Here are three reasons to choose multi-ply over single ply bellows.

  1. Able to Handle Strong Vibrations

    Many workers need to make sure their equipment will hold up to strong vibrations. If vibrations become too strong, it could cause your machinery to break down. Fortunately, multi-ply bellows are able to withstand vibrations. In turn, this allows you to continue to work in a safe manner.
  2. Extreme Flexibility

    It’s also important to ensure that your bellows are flexible. Unfortunately, it’s difficult to achieve this goal while using single ply bellows. On the other hand, multi-ply bellows often consist of two or three tubes. In certain situations, these types of bellows can have as many as five tubes. These varying amount of tubes help ensure that multi-ply bellows remain flexible. Considering that, many people choose multi-ply bellows for their superior flexibility.
  3. Greater Resistance to Pressure

    While working in the oil and gas extraction industry, it’s wise to pay close attention to pressure levels. If not, you could be dealing with potentially unsafe working conditions. You’ll be glad to know that multi-ply bellows work well at standing up to all sorts of pressure. Therefore, another reason to choose multi-ply bellows is that they are able to withstand immense amounts of pressure.
